Informatică, întrebare adresată de grandejace, 8 ani în urmă

Problema 1
Să se scrie un program care numără elementele pozitive din tablou.
Problema 2
Se dă un vector cu n componente numere întregi. Să se micşoreze cu 2 toate componentele impare din tablou.
Vă rog e urgent, măcar una

Răspunsuri la întrebare

Răspuns de Levi20
0

Pb 1

#include <iostream>

using namespace std;

int main()

{

int n,a[101],nr=0;

cin>>n;

for(int i=1;i<=n;i++)

{

cin>>a[i];

if(a[i]>0)

nr++;

}

cout<<nr;

return 0;

}

Pb 2

#include <iostream>

using namespace std;

int main()

{

int n,a[101];

cin>>n;

for(int i=1;i<=n;i++)

{

cin>>a[i];

if(a[i]%2==1)

a[i]-=2;

}

for(int i=1;i<=n;i++)

cout<<a[i]<<" ";

return 0;

}

Alte întrebări interesante